Networking, the process of developing relationship allicances with key people; 2.Terms in this set (16) Power. is a person's ability to influence others to do something they would not otherwise do. Position Power. is derived from top-level management and is delegated down the chain of command. Personal Power. is derived from the person. Everyone has it to varying degrees.

Your Expertise. If you want or need to influence others in your organization and motivate them to listen to you, one of the surest methods is to develop expertise in your discipline, industry, or both. Doing so allows you to position yourself as an authority and a resource.
